What to Expect from the Tour

Cappadocia: Private Half-Day Vineyards & Wine Tasting Tour - What to Expect from the Tour

We loved the way this tour combines scenic drives with educational moments. Starting around 9:30-10:00 am, your private vehicle will pick you up from your hotel in a comfortable setting, setting the tone for a relaxed, intimate experience. The drive itself is pleasant, offering plenty of opportunities to admire the vivid vineyard landscapes that stretch across Cappadocia’s rolling hills.

Visiting the Vineyards

Once at the vineyards, you’ll get a chance to see where the region’s best grapes grow, and even participate in picking your own. This isn’t just a quick look; it’s a genuine chance to get your hands dirty and connect with the land. Expect to see local grape varieties, and your guide will explain what makes these grapes special for winemaking.

Many reviews note how knowledgeable and friendly the guides are. One reviewer, Clark, mentioned how the guide was “so friendly and helpful,” and highlighted the chance to taste a variety of wines and fruits. You’ll also have plenty of photo opportunities here—imagine yourself with vines and grapes in the background, soaking in the peaceful scenery.

Visiting Turasan Winery

Next up is the Turasan Winery, the biggest producer in Cappadocia. It’s the perfect spot to learn more about the region’s wine production process and taste a selection of local wines. You’ll get to sample different varieties, which can range from dry reds to aromatic whites, and possibly some local specialties. Many travelers find the tastings very enjoyable, especially with a guide explaining the nuances of each wine.

One review described the experience as “much more than just a wine tasting,” noting the “ambiance and personal touches” that made the visit special. The opportunity to learn directly from the winery staff adds authenticity to the experience, making it more memorable than simply drinking wine in a bar.

FAQs About the Cappadocia Wine Tour

Is this a private tour?
Yes, the experience is designed for private groups, which means you’ll have your own guide and vehicle, ensuring a personalized experience.

What is included in the price?
The tour includes hotel pickup and drop-off, a professional guide, wine tasting, a luxury vehicle with driver, and all taxes and handling charges.

Are meals included?
No, food is not included in this tour. You might want to plan for a meal afterward or bring snacks, depending on your schedule.

How long does the tour last?
It’s approximately 4 hours, starting around 9:30-10:00 am, depending on your hotel pickup.

Can I visit more than just vineyards and the winery?
The main focus is on the vineyards and Turasan Winery, but additional visits to other local vineyards or wineries could be included depending on the day.

Is there a dress code?
There’s no strict dress code, but comfortable, casual clothing suitable for walking in vineyards is recommended.

Are children allowed on this tour?
The data doesn’t specify age restrictions, but as it involves vineyard walking and tasting, it’s best suited for adults or older children.

Is alcohol consumption safe if I’m driving?
Since the tour includes wine tastings but also hotel drop-off, you won’t need to worry about driving afterward. Always drink responsibly.

What if I need to cancel?
You can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ility if your plans change.
